Ingredients for Dolly’s Chicken and Stuffing Casserole

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Chicken Breasts Use boneless, skinless chicken breasts for convenience. You can also use leftover cooked chicken or rotisserie chicken to save time.
  • Stuffing Mix Choose your favorite boxed stuffing mix; herb, cornbread, or even gluten-free options work well. Adjust the seasonings to your liking.
  • Cream of Mushroom Soup This provides a creamy, comforting base for the casserole. You can substitute with cream of chicken or celery soup if you prefer.
  • Chicken Broth Adds moisture and flavor to the stuffing. Use low-sodium broth to control the saltiness of the dish.
  • Onion Diced onion adds a savory element to the casserole. Yellow or white onions work best.
  • Celery Diced celery provides a subtle crunch and adds another layer of flavor.
  • Butter Adds richness and helps to bind the stuffing together. You can use olive oil as a substitute.
  • Dried Thyme Adds an earthy, aromatic flavor to the casserole. You can substitute with other herbs like sage or rosemary.
  • Salt and Pepper Season to taste, enhancing the overall flavor of the dish.

How to Make Dolly’s Chicken and Stuffing Casserole

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Step 1: Prep the Chicken

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Cut ch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ces. Season with salt, pepper, and a pinch of dried thyme. This ensures even cooking and flavorful chicken throughout the casserole.

Step 2: Sauté Vegetables

In a large sk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add diced onion and celery and sauté until softened, about 5-7 minutes. These aromatics create a flavorful foundation for the casserole.

Step 3: Combine Ingredients

In a large bowl, combine the stuffing mix, sautéed vegetables, cream of mushroom soup, and chicken broth. Stir until well combined. Make sure the stuffing is evenly moistened for the best texture.

Step 4: Assemble the Casserole

Spread half of the stuffing mixture into the bottom of a greased 9×13 inch baking dish. Layer the chicken pieces over the stuffing, then top with the remaining stuffing mixture. This layering ensures each bite is packed with flavor.

Step 5: Bake to Golden Perfection

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il and bake for 30 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for an additional 15-20 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and the casserole is heated through. The foil helps to keep the casserole moist, while removing it allows the top to get perfectly browned.

Step 6: Let it Rest and Serve

Let the casserole rest for 5-10 minutes before serving. This allows the flavors to meld together and the casserole to set slightly. Serve warm and enjoy! This dish pairs perfectly with a side of green beans or a fresh salad for a complete and satisfying meal.

Dolly’s Chicken and Stuffing Casserole

5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star

No reviews

Pin Recipe

Delicious dolly’s chicken and stuffing casserole recipe with detailed instructions and nutritional information.

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ings

Ingredients

  • Cooked chicken, shredded: 3 cups
  • Prepared stuffing mix: 6 cups
  • Cream of chicken soup: 1 can (10.75 ounces)
  • Cream of mushroom soup: 1 can (10.75 ounces)
  • Chicken broth: 1/2 cup
  • Sour cream: 1/2 cup
  • Celery, diced: 1/2 cup
  • Onion, diced: 1/4 cup

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Lightly grease a 9×13 inch baking dish.
  2. Step 2: In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, stuffing mix, cream of chicken soup, cream of mushroom soup, chicken broth, sour cream, celery, and onion. Mix well to ensure all ingredients are evenly distributed.
  3. Step 3: Pour the chicken and stuffing mixture into the prepared baking dish and spread evenly.
  4. Step 4: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il.
  5. Step 5: Bake for 30 minutes covered. Remove foil and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es, or until heated through and the top is lightly browned.

Notes

  • For easy make-ahead meals, assemble the casserole and store it, unbaked and well-covered, in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ours.
  • To reheat leftovers, cover with foil and bake at 350°F (175°C) until warmed through, or microwave individual portions.
  • Serve Dolly's Chicken and Stuffing Casserole with a side of cranberry sauce or a simple green salad for a complete and comforting meal.
  • For extra flavor, saute the celery and onion in a little butter before adding them to the mix.

FAQs :

Can I prepare Dolly’s Chicken and Stuffing Casserole ahead of time?

Absolutely! One of the best things about this casserole is its make-ahead potential. You can assemble the entire casserole a day or two in advance, cover it tightly with plastic wrap, and store it in the refrigerator. When you’re ready to bake, simply take it out of the fridge about 30 minutes before and pop it in the oven. This is a lifesaver for busy weeknights or when you’re expecting guests and want to get a head start on the cooking. Just be sure to add a few extra minutes to the baking time to ensure it’s heated through completely.

What can I serve with this amazing Chicken and Stuffing Casserole?

This casserole is a hearty meal on its own, but it pairs wonderfully with a variety of side dishes. Consider serving it with some steamed green beans or roasted asparagus for a touch of green. A simple side salad with a light vinaigrette would also complement the richness of the casserole nicely. For a more substantial meal, you could add a side of cranberry sauce or a warm dinner roll. Ultimately, the best sides are those that you and your family enjoy!

How do I prevent the stuffing from drying out in my Dolly’s Chicken and Stuffing Casserole?

Nobody wants dry stuffing! To keep your stuffing moist and delicious, make sure to add enough broth. The stuffing should be damp, but not soggy, before you put it in the casserole dish. Another trick is to cover the casserole with foil during the first half of the baking time. This will trap moisture and prevent the top from drying out. Remove the foil during the last 15-20 minutes to allow the top to brown and crisp up. You could also add a layer of gravy over the stuffing before baking for extra moisture and flavor.

What kind of chicken should I use for the Best Chicken and Stuffing Casserole?

You have options! Leftover cooked chicken is perfect for this casserole. Rotisserie chicken is another great choice for convenience. If you’re cooking chicken specifically for the casserole, boneless, skinless chicken breasts or thighs work well. Just be sure to cook the chicken thoroughly and shred or dice it into bite-sized pieces before adding it to the casserole. You can even use ground chicken for a slightly different texture. Whatever you choose, make sure it’s cooked and ready to go before assembling the casserole.
